Many of these beings were similar to ones whom historic Woodland and Plains Indians recognized and with whom they interrelated, allied, and coped. A few examples best known to ethnohistorical and archaeological researchers of past Woodland and Plains Indians are the thunderers, horned serpents, and underwater panthers.著名 发表于 2025-3-29 10:23:01
